Aim: To drill mathematical skills, give students insight in fundamental mathematical ideas and methods and teach students to formulate, analyze and solve problems from different relevant technical areas. Furthermore, enhance students proficiency in implementing mathematical ideas and methods and in comprehending and applying methods relevant to the syllabus and further studies.
Contents: Elementary functions. Techniques of integration and differentiation including partial fractions. Complex numbers and complex functions of one variable. Taylor series. L'Hospital's rule. First-order differential equations. Second- and higher order linear differential equations and systems of linear differential equations with constant coefficients by analytical methods and by the Laplace transform.
